Mathematica中使用分段函数绘制流线图

Mathematic中内置了绘制流线图的函数“StreamPlot”。笔者在这里使用此函数绘制流线图时发现“StreamPlot”不支持使用“Piecewise”创建的分段函数:



所以这里考虑使用另一种方法来表示分段函数:

如此一来,我们便可以使用分段函数绘制流线图了。若分段函数仅有两段,还可以使用“If”来表示。
由于不清楚Mathematica中是否可以使用逻辑表达式来表示分段函数,比如在Fortran里,g可表示为:

  g=-v*(u<=0.3333333)+(1-6.75*u*(u-1)**2-v)*(u<=1.and.u>=0.333333)+(1-v)*(u>1)

所以采用了此方法。

若有错误之处还请指出

Mathematica中使用分段函数绘制流线图相关推荐

  1. 使用Python扩展库numpy中的piecewise()函数实现分段函数模拟兔子的行走轨迹,然后使用matplotlib.pyplot中的plot函数绘制折线图表示兔子和乌龟的时间位移图,并添加坐标

    import matplotlib.pyplot as plt import numpy as np #使用参数字典 rcParams 访问并修改已经加载的配置项 plt.rcParams['font ...

  2. 用r语言画出y = ax^2 + bx + c,R语言中使用curve函数绘制常用函数曲线

    前面文章中介绍了使用plot函数绘制图形的方法.本文介绍一下使用R中curve函数绘制常见函数曲线的方法. 1.curve函数简介 curve函数语法格式如下: curve(expr, from = ...

  3. matlab中求分段函数的分段点,matlab求解分段函数问题是如何用下面的算法求解下面的分段函数 爱问知识人...

    问题是如何用下面的算法求解下面的分段函数,目前出现的问题是:??? Error using ==> at 11Function 'gt' is not implemented for MuPAD ...

  4. MATLAB中使用streamline函数绘制正负点电荷及它们构成的电偶极子的电场线分布图

    电场强度等于电势梯度乘以-1,而这些代码在调用gradient函数求偏导后并没有乘以-1. 先把上一篇博客中不严谨的代码拿出来: % 在二维平面上绘制一个正点电荷的电场线图. k = 8.9875e+ ...

  5. Python中Turtle绘图函数-绘制时钟程序

    Turtle常用的一些函数, 参考博客:http://blog.csdn.net/zengxiantao1994/article/details/76588580 时钟代码设计 我们可以通过main函 ...

  6. matlab 分段符号函数,Octave符号包中的分段函数?

    Matlab的 piecewise功能似乎相当新(在2016b中引入),但它基本上看起来像一个美化的三元运算符.不幸的是,我没有2016年检查它是否对输入执行任何检查,但通常您可以通过使用逻辑索引索引 ...

  7. Word中怎么打分段函数?

    分段函数也是中学时代需要学习的一种函数,它的特有特征就是自带一个大括号,然后包含了几个函数解析式,其实对于分段函数,大家应该都不陌生,那么如何在Word中打分段函数呢?下面就给大家分享具体的编辑技巧. ...

  8. Origin 绘制分段函数图

    Origin 绘制分段函数图 绘图–>函数图–>2D函数图 设置函数参数:x的单位是0到2*pi,取100个点,y=sin(x) 注:输入函数时需要切换到英文输入法 鼠标点击工作簿,重复第 ...

  9. MatLab绘制分段函数激活函数

    1 MatLab绘制二维图像 1.0 语法 函数 % 'r'曲线颜色,'lineWidth'曲线宽度 plot(x,y,'r','lineWidth',1) 标题 title('图片描述') 坐标轴标 ...

最新文章

  1. docker strace ptrace 报错 Operation not permitted 解决方法
  2. 整车厂核心制造系统及数据流
  3. [FFT/IFFT]快速傅里叶(逆)变化 + 递归和递推模板
  4. JBoss模块很糟糕,无法在JBoss 7下使用自定义Resteasy / JAX-RS
  5. Spring整合JMS——基于ActiveMQ实现(一)
  6. 超过100G的CVPR 2020 图像匹配挑战赛数据下载!
  7. C语言自学之路十四(详解C语言初阶结构体)
  8. PyQt5 QLabel控件
  9. 重庆大学计算机学院小学期安排,2019年重庆大学寒假放假时间安排是什么 重庆大学2019年学校校历如何安排...
  10. i.max6 e9 android系统添加3G模块支持 上
  11. 系统分析员到底做什么?
  12. pandas精华总结
  13. 内存卡打不开提示格式化?数据恢复怎么弄?
  14. linux c/c++使用sqlite3读取数据
  15. register关键字的使用
  16. IE浏览器图标不见了
  17. 深度学习第一篇论文——半监督学习Mean Teacher 的学习
  18. QQ2013协议分析(解密篇)
  19. NTP Client Error -- ntpstat shows unsynchronised
  20. spring定时器@Scheduled的原理和实现分析

热门文章

  1. 同步机无传感滑膜观测器模型加代码 仿真模型+代码(基于28035
  2. 工业产品类计算机绘图师,工业产品类CAD技能一级(二维计算机绘图)CAXA培训教程...
  3. 【动态规划】最长上升字符串、词语接龙问题
  4. gRPC 入门使用教程
  5. mac上快速截图/屏幕录制快捷键
  6. Unity3d的2D骨骼动画插件Puppet2D的使用2
  7. 医院实时监护系统(数据流图)
  8. 6000端口有毒,谷歌浏览器访问不到
  9. pymysql 报错:from . import connections # noqa: E402
  10. 338 道架构师面试题,CTO 都顶不住。。